Consumer Litigation Counsel (Remote)

Seyfarth Shaw LLP is a leading law firm that values great people and invests in their professional development. They are seeking a Consumer Litigation Counsel to manage high volume single plaintiff consumer litigation cases, involving tasks such as drafting motions, negotiating settlements, and preparing cases for trial.

Responsibilities

Manage high volume single plaintiff consumer litigation cases
Work directly with opposing counsel
Draft motions and pleadings
Negotiate settlement
Handle court appearances
Prepare the case for trial
Have substantive client contact
Significant involvement in case strategy and management

Required

At least 5 years of general litigation experience, preferably single plaintiff work
Strong work ethic and ability to drive cases to resolution
Excellent academic credentials
Analytical skills, and verbal and written communication skills

Preferred

Fair Credit Reporting Act litigation experience and/or other consumer litigation experience preferred
Top law firm experience, or a combination of law firm and in-house experience
